Important Announcement
PubHTML5 Scheduled Server Maintenance on (GMT) Sunday, June 26th, 2:00 am - 8:00 am.
PubHTML5 site will be inoperative during the times indicated!

Home Explore How to Select the Right NodeJS Development Company

How to Select the Right NodeJS Development Company

Published by Jacob Michael, 2023-06-05 09:32:25

Description: As a business owner, it is crucial to choose a proficient NodeJS development company in the USA to effectively harness the potential of NodeJS for launching powerful cross-platform applications.

Keywords: nodejs development company usa,best nodejs development company

Search

Read the Text Version

How to Select the Right NodeJS Development Company As a business owner, it is crucial to choose a proficient NodeJS development company in the USA to effectively harness the potential of NodeJS for launching powerful cross- platform applications. However, determining which company possesses the capabilities to deliver innovative technological solutions can be challenging. Ensuring alignment with a company that consistently prioritizes meeting your project requirements is essential. To address these concerns and minimize the risk of making an incorrect decision, our experts have developed an informative blog that will assist you in making a wise choice. We will explore several key factors in selecting the top-notch NodeJS development company. But before that, let's grasp the reasons for your initial requirement of NodeJS. Why is NodeJS so Popular? Node.js has gained significant popularity among developers worldwide due to its numerous benefits and advantages. Here are some of the key reasons behind its widespread adoption: Full-Stack JavaScript: Node.js enables developers to build both client-side and server- side applications using JavaScript, making it a great choice for full-stack development. This eliminates the need for separate teams and allows for seamless communication between frontend and backend development. Agility: Node.js leverages Google's V8 JavaScript engine, which is built on C++, providing developers with a lightweight and agile platform. This enables faster development and improved performance for applications. Hosting Compatibility: The Node.js ecosystem is compatible with a wide range of hosting services, including popular options like Amazon Web Services, Google Cloud

Platform, Heroku, and more. This flexibility allows developers to choose the hosting solution that best suits their needs. Caching: Node.js is designed to efficiently handle concurrent requests by utilizing an event-driven and single-threaded architecture. Its caching ability allows for the storage of data, resulting in faster response times and improved application speed. Easy Sharing: Node.js comes with built-in support for package management through Node Package Manager (NPM). This makes it easy for developers to share and deploy code, enhancing collaboration and productivity. Flexibility and Scalability: Node.js is based on a non-blocking event loop system, which provides flexibility and scalability for building applications. It allows developers to handle a large number of simultaneous connections without compromising performance. Modern Architecture: Node.js supports an iterative software development process and encourages the use of microservices architecture. This enables efficient communication between different parts of an application, leading to improved performance and productivity. Open-Source Community: Node.js has a thriving open-source community, which fosters collaboration among developers worldwide. The community actively contributes to the development and improvement of Node.js, ensuring it stays up-to-date with the latest technology trends and market expectations. Node.js is particularly well-suited for building complex applications such as Single Page Applications (SPAs), real-time chat apps, streaming solutions, and IoT-based products and services. It offers the necessary tools and support for these demanding use cases. About NodeJS Development Company As a Node.js development company in USA, we cater to the diverse project requirements of startups, SMEs, and legacy enterprises across various industry verticals. Our

commitment lies in delivering high-quality Node.js development services tailored to meet specific business needs. Here is an overview of the services we offer: API Development: We specialize in creating scalable and efficient RESTful APIs that ensure seamless connectivity with third-party components, enabling smooth integration with other systems. Plugins Development: Leverage the power of custom plugins development with Node.js. Our team can build plugins, modules, and other extensions specific to your project requirements, providing unmatched web development experiences. UI/UX Development: Benefit from world-class design patterns, UI/UX architecture, motion graphics, and animation expertise. We develop and deploy web and mobile applications that offer a seamless interactive user experience. Real-time Chat Apps Development: Utilize popular web technologies, tools, frameworks, and IDEs to develop contemporary real-time chat apps. We can build instant messaging solutions to expand your user base and enhance user engagement. Migration Services: Our team provides comprehensive support and assistance in migrating your existing applications from other frameworks to Node.js. We ensure a faster and smoother migration process, aligning with your preferred technologies. Ajax Development: Create high-performance, dynamic, and multipurpose Ajax applications and web portals using JavaScript, CSS, XHTML, and XML HTTP Request. We leverage the most widely used web development tools and technologies to deliver exceptional results. Support and Maintenance: Enhance the performance of your applications with our well- defined support and maintenance services. We provide guidance and assistance in planning and executing updates, as well as modifying existing features and functionalities as required.

Node.js Consulting: Take advantage of our full-fledged Node.js consulting services to effectively manage and execute your projects. Our experienced Node.js consultants can help you establish project roadmaps, address major development issues, choose the right tech stack, and allocate responsibilities. Node.js Outsourcing: Simplify the hiring process by outsourcing your Node.js development requirements. Whether you need individual developers or an entire development team, we offer flexible outsourcing options to exceed your expectations. With our expertise in Node.js development, we aim to deliver robust and innovative solutions that drive business growth and success. A Step-by-Step Process to Choose the Best NodeJS Development Company Define Your Project Requirements: Clearly identify your project goals, objectives, and requirements. Determine the scope of your project, technology stack preferences, budget, and timeline. Research and Shortlist Companies: Conduct thorough research to identify potential Node.js development companies. Look for companies with a strong portfolio, relevant experience, and positive client reviews. Shortlist a few companies that align with your project requirements. Evaluate Expertise and Experience: Assess the expertise and experience of the shortlisted companies. Look for companies with a proven track record in Node.js development. Consider their experience in working on similar projects and their ability to handle complex requirements. Check Technical Skills: Evaluate the technical skills of the development team. Verify their proficiency in Node.js, JavaScript, relevant frameworks, libraries, and databases. A skilled team will be able to deliver high-quality code and handle any challenges that arise

during development. Review Portfolio and Case Studies: Take a close look at the company's portfolio and case studies. This will give you an idea of their previous projects, industries they have worked in, and the quality of their work. Look for projects that demonstrate their expertise in Node.js development. Assess Communication and Collaboration: Effective communication and collaboration are crucial for successful project execution. Evaluate how the company communicates with clients, their responsiveness, and their ability to understand and translate your requirements into technical solutions. Client References: Request client references from the shortlisted companies. Reach out to their past clients and inquire about their experience working with the company. Ask about the company's professionalism, reliability, adherence to deadlines, and the overall satisfaction with their services. Consider Scalability and Support: Ensure that the chosen company has the capability to scale the project as per your future requirements. Additionally, inquire about their post- development support and maintenance services. A reliable company will provide ongoing support to address any issues that may arise after the project is completed. Cost and Contract: Obtain detailed cost estimates from the shortlisted companies. Compare the costs, taking into account the quality of services offered. Review the contract terms and conditions, including ownership of code, intellectual property rights, and confidentiality clauses. Make an Informed Decision: Finally, weigh all the factors mentioned above and make an informed decision. Choose the Node.js development company that best aligns with your project requirements, budget, and overall vision. By following this step-by-step process, you can identify and select the best Node.js development company to partner with for your project's success.

How can Hepto Technologies Help? Hepto Technologies can provide valuable assistance in your Node.js development endeavors. Here's how we can help: Expert Node.js Developers: We have a team of seasoned Node.js experts who can be hired according to your specific project requirements. Our developers are experienced in building robust and scalable Node.js applications, ensuring that your project is in capable hands. Comprehensive Services: Whether you need custom development, UI/UX design, app migration and upgrade, or building a product from scratch, our Node.js development team is equipped to handle all your requirements effectively. We offer end-to-end solutions to meet your business needs. Quality and Excellence: With over a decade of experience in the industry, we prioritize delivering high-quality solutions. Our team of software developers, app engineers, and product consultants is dedicated to ensuring that your Node.js applications are of superior quality, providing a seamless user experience. Source Code Protection and Confidentiality: We understand the importance of protecting your intellectual property. We implement the best security measures to ensure the confidentiality and protection of your source code throughout the development process. Flexible Engagement Models: Our engagement models are designed to provide flexibility and cater to your specific needs. You can hire our Node.js developers based on your project requirements, whether you need a dedicated team or individual developers. Technical Expertise: We stay up-to-date with the latest trends and advancements in Node.js development. Our technical expertise allows us to leverage the best practices and deliver modern, innovative solutions that meet your business goals. Value-based Services: Our aim is to provide value-driven services that help your

business thrive and generate profitable outcomes in the long run. We focus on understanding your business requirements and delivering solutions that align with your goals. By partnering with Hepto Technologies, you gain access to our experienced Node.js developers, technical expertise, and a commitment to delivering high-quality solutions. We ensure that your Node.js web and mobile applications are built to the highest standards, meeting the needs of your end-users. Conclusion Choosing the best Node.js development company is crucial to fully leverage the benefits of this cross-platform technology. Partnering with a reliable Node.js development company will ensure the creation of high-quality applications that effectively meet user demands. If you are looking to enhance your in-house Node.js capabilities and bridge any skill gaps, our team augmentation service model provides the opportunity to hire skilled developers within your budget.


Like this book? You can publish your book online for free in a few minutes!
Create your own flipbook